Gerhard Heinrich Sawatsky, age 81 of 9422 Cook Street Chilliwack died July 28, 1982 at St. Paul's Hospital.
Funeral service was at Glad Tidings Fellowship. Pastors Dave Huebert, Jim Gaetz and Lorne Lueck officiated. Burial was at the Yarrow Cemetery.
Pallbearers were Mervin Effa, Rudy Runzer, Leonard and David Sperling, Kenneth Scarrow and Tony Heppner.
Gerhard Heinrich was born March 4, 1901 at Andreasfeld, Chortitza South Russia to Heinrich G. & Susanna (Goerzen) Sawatsky and came to Canada with his family to Aberdeen,
Sask at the age of 10 months. George married Eva Funk on June 9, 1924 at Warman Saskatchewan at Brotherfield Mennonite Brethren Church west of Waldheim. George and Eva
moved from Aberdeen, SK., to Yarrow, B.C. in 1943 and became members of Yarrow MB Church. Four daughters were born to them: Laura, Susan, Frances and Evangeline. Eva passed
away January 14, 1976

George lived in Yarrow until his retirement in 1978. He was a construction worker. He was also a chairman of maintenance at the Yarrow M.B. Church and a director on the
Chilliwack Regional Fair Board and chairman of the hobbies section. He was also a member of the Fraser Valley brush and Palette Club and Community Arts & Crafts.
He is survived by his wife Hilda Sperling; four daughters: Laura (Mervin) Effa, Phoenix, Arizona; Susan (Dave) Sperling, Abbotsford BC; Frances (Gerald) Harder, Outlook, Saskatchewan;
Evangeline (Kenneth) Scarrow, Langley, BC; 11 grandchildren and six great-grandchildren; two brothers: John Sawatsky of Abbotsford and Dr. David Stanwood of Vancouver; two sisters:
Susie (Nicolai) Bauman of Mission and Helen (John) Andres of Abbotsford and three step-sons: David Sperling of Chilliwack; Len Sperling of Abbotsford and Don Sperling of Beaver Lodge,
Alberta; two step-daughters: Hazel( Mrs. R) Runzer of Burnaby, and Frances (Pastor Dave) Huebert, of Chilliwack; eight step-grandchildren and three step-great-grandchildren.
